Vancouver, Washington is taking major steps to make growth more equitable and inclusive. Building on its Reside Vancouver Anti-Displacement Strategy, the city is now developing a citywide Equitable Development Strategy that connects housing stability, economic opportunity, and community investment.
Reside Vancouver focuses on four pillars โ People, Preservation, Production, and Prosperity โ to strengthen renter protections, preserve affordable housing, and support long-term community wealth. The cityโs Fourth Plain corridor has served as a model, with projects like the Fourth Plain Community Commons, which opened in 2023 with 106 affordable housing units and a 2,500-square-foot commissary kitchen for local entrepreneurs…
